So do I, you really should play FF VI (actual VI these days) if you haven't, its STILL one of the best RPGs of all time IMO...I would buy a remake of that game even after playing it on every single console its existed to the very end, I'm just done paying for copies of the same exact game (most with the relm sketch glitch removed (n)) since I bought it and still own it on almost every system I still have to this day.

If you liked the Class changing games and that one I mentioned, I can't possible see you not liking part VI. Instead of changing classes you change Espers, which let you learn Magic as well as Increase a single stat on the character they are equipped on when they level up (this is where it actually gets class-like), but at the same time each character has their own special skill like Steal (which can be changed by equipment to attack when stealing, steal 4 times, etc) and certain armor/weapons they can equip. On the original version you could make certain characters unable to be hit by any attack in the game by raising Magic Evade to the max since Physical evade had a glitch and it was a sort of dual evade stat. Being a god everything misses is fun, but of course kind of breaks the game, same with the sketch glitch I mentioned.
